> Its container specific. Also to do so - the Realm would have 
> to provide that 
> ability - so even this is Realm specfic too.
> 
> http://jakarta.apache.org/tomcat/tomcat-4.1-doc/realm-howto.html
> 
> And to top if off - You app will need to be be a "privledged" 
> webapp so it 
> may see the catalina internals. (which is where realms live)
> 
> -Tim
> 
> 
> Christian J. Dechery - ACCENTURE wrote:
> > Is there a way I can query the container's user database to 
> find out if a
> > specifed login exists or not??
> >  
> > If yes, is the solution container-specific?
